Avatar billede limemedia Nybegynder
03. januar 2004 - 14:59 Der er 1 løsning

Lokal tidszone til GMT konvertering

Jeg har brug for at konvertere et datetime og et timestamp felt i en mySQL database til GMT formatet. datetime feltet vil indeholde serverens lokale tid (udvikling kører JST mens drift kører GMT+1)

Pt. anvender jeg kommandoen
DATE_FORMAT(c.created, '%a, %e %b %Y %H:%i:%s GMT') AS f_created

Denne tager ikke forhold for, hvilken tidszone serveren befinder sig i. Jeg har forsøgt at travle mysql's dokumentation igennem for at finde en kommando der kan konvertere mellem to tidszoner, hvor den ene er serverens egen (da mine maskiner er i forskellige tidszoner er en simpel "træk x antal timer fra) ikke særlig brugbar. Der er også en hyggelig parameter i, at JST kører uden sommer/vintertid.

Jeg vil helst undgå "ugly-hack" løsninger og kan godt leve med at tidsstemplet er forkert i et sådant tilfælde.

Idéer ?

/ LJ
Avatar billede limemedia Nybegynder
08. januar 2004 - 20:32 #1
Dét skete der ikke meget ved
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ester

IT-JOB

Capgemini Danmark A/S

SAP S/4HANA Business Controlling

SOS International

Platform Engineer

Forsikrings- og pensionsakademiet A/S

IT-teknisk profil

Netcompany A/S

Managing Architect